Programme qui lit les notes de N élèves(N compris entre 20 et 50) d’une classe dans un devoir et les mémorise dans un tableau POINTS de N éléments
Guide pratique : Programme qui lit les notes de N élèves(N compris entre 20 et 50) d’une classe dans un devoir et les mémorise dans un tableau POINTS de N éléments. Recherche parmi 300 000+ dissertationsPar Francky Willy • 12 Janvier 2019 • Guide pratique • 443 Mots (2 Pages) • 795 Vues
[pic 1] République du bénin [pic 2]
MINISTERE DE L’ENSEIGNEMENT supérieur et de la recherche scientifique
UNIVERSITé AFRICAINE DE TECHNOLOGIE ET DE MANAGEMENT GASA FORMATION
Génie électrique/Rit2
PROJET C++
[pic 3]
Programme qui lit les notes de N élèves(N compris entre 20 et 50) d’une classe dans un devoir et les mémorise dans un tableau POINTS de N éléments
Membres du groupe
AKERELE Adéchola
HOUNDJO-FONNOU Andréï
SOSSOU Wilfried Sous la direction de : M. Marc-Aurèl AKPONNA
ANNEE ACADEMIQUE 2018-2019
Code source du programme
#include
using namespace std;
//#define N 10
void Saisir(int tableau[],int N){
int note;
for(int i=0;i
do{
if(i==0){
cout<<"Entrez la note du 1 er eleve ";
}else{
cout<<"Entrez la note du "<
}
cin>>note;
if(note<0 || note>20){
cout<<"ERREUR !!! Entrez un nombre compris entre 0 et 20 svp "<
}
}while(note<0 || note>20);
tableau[i]=note;
}
}
void Affiche(int tableau[],int N){
cout<<"|";
for(int i=0;i
cout<
}
cout<
}
int Maximum(int tableau[],int N){
int maxi=tableau[0];
for(int i=0;i
if(tableau[i]>maxi){
maxi=tableau[i];
}
}
return maxi;
}
void Minimum(int tableau[],int N){
int mini=tableau[0];
for(int i=0;i
if(tableau[i]
mini=tableau[i];
}
}
cout<<"La note minimale est : "<
}
void Moyenne(int tableau[],int N){
double moy=0;
for(int i=0;i
moy+=tableau[i];
}
moy/=N;
cout<<"La moyenne des notes est : "<
}
void R_Notes(int NOTES[7],int tableau[],int N){
for(int i=0;i<7;i++){
NOTES[i]=0;
}
for(int i=0;i
if(tableau[i]<=5){
NOTES[0]++;
}
if(tableau[i]==7 || tableau[i]==6){
NOTES[1]++;
}
if(tableau[i]==9 || tableau[i]==8){
NOTES[2]++;
}
if(tableau[i]==10 || tableau[i]==11){
NOTES[3]++;
}
if(tableau[i]>=12 && tableau[i]<=14){
NOTES[4]++;
}
if(tableau[i]>=15 && tableau[i]<=17){
NOTES[5]++;
}
if(tableau[i]>=18 && tableau[i]<=20){
NOTES[6]++;
}
}
}
...